The perfect summer party appetizer! It has it all, the spice, the sweet, and the heat if you like. Chill for several hours to let all the flavors meld and marry!
5 ears fresh corn, shucked
Cooking spray for grill or grill pan
½ cup Greek yogurt
2 tablespoons mayonnaise
2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
½ teaspoon garlic powder
½ teaspoon onion powder
½ teaspoon sea salt
3 to 4 green onions chopped, reserving some for topping
1 jalapeño pepper, seeded and diced, reserving some for topping
1 tablespoon or more Cotija crumbling cheese
1 tablespoon hot sauce
½ teaspoon chili powder
½ teaspoon smoked paprika
Fresh cilantro leaves, for topping
Tortilla chips for serving
Heat grill or grill pan to high heat and coat with cooking spray. Grill corn for several minutes per side or until slightly charred. Remove from heat and let corn cool enough to handle. Cut kernels from cobb and place in a large bowl. Add Greek yogurt, mayonnaise, lime juice, and seasonings. Stir until well combined. Set aside some of the corn, green onion, and jalapeño pepper for garnish and add remaining corn, green onion, and jalapeño to bowl and stir to coat. Chill for several hours. When ready to serve, spread chilled corn in a shallow serving dish and top with reserved grilled corn, green onions, and jalapeño peppers. Sprinkle cheese on top and drizzle with additional hot sauce if desired. Garnish with cilantro leaves and serve with tortilla chips.
Yield: 6 servings
